Golem | Bestiary Dragon's Dogma Guide

Description: The Golem is several tons of stone fuelled by powerful magick. Its characterized by clearly visible weak spots in different parts of its body.

Location: Outside BlueMoon Tower, Tomb of The Unknown Traveller (near the Bloodwater Beach), Moonsbit Pass (after killing the Dragon), The Everfall, Witchwood (during the Witch Hunt quest).

Attacks: The Golem has several types of arm swings, punches and blows. It can also suck the life energy from its enemies (by holding them in its hand). The boss' special attack is a laser which causes explosions. If you interrupt it by an arrow (when the Golem is busy loading the missiles) you can cause it to fall down.

Weakness: Weak spots - glowing discs.

Resistance: Magick.

Strategy: When fighting the Golem, focus on its weak spots - the discs glowing on its body. There are several of them - on its arms, torso, head and legs. There is even one spot on the sole of one of the feet. After destroying a disc it's better to fall back, because that's when the Golem can attack with double strength (though it will become immobile for a moment). In time, its movements will become slower.

Metal Golem

Description: The Metal Golem is a special version of the Golem, which is quite rare, but can be quite challenging. Especially to mage characters.

Location: Witchwood (during the Witch Hunt quest), The Everfall (Chamber of Estrangement).

Attacks: The Metal Golem is much more mobile and dangerous. It also has weak spots, but the difference is that they are scattered in the area around it. Watch closely to locate them - they glow in the direction of the enemy. The weak spot discs are highly resistant to magick, so spellcaster may be having some difficulties in this fight.
